Pull orangefs updates from Mike Marshall:
 "Orangefs cleanups, fixes and statx support.

  Some cleanups:

   - remove unused get_fsid_from_ino
   - fix bounds check for listxattr
   - clean up oversize xattr validation
   - do not set getattr_time on orangefs_lookup
   - return from orangefs_devreq_read quickly if possible
   - do not wait for timeout if umounting
   - handle zero size write in debugfs

  Bug fixes:

   - do not check possibly stale size on truncate
   - ensure the userspace component is unmounted if mount fails
   - total reimplementation of dir.c

  New feature:

   - implement statx

  The new implementation of dir.c is kind of a big deal, all new code.
  It has been posted to fs-devel during the previous rc period, we
  didn't get much review or feedback from there, but it has been
  reviewed very heavily here, so much so that we have two entire
  versions of the reimplementation.

  Not only does the new implementation fix some xfstests, but it passes
  all the new tests we made here that involve seeking and rewinding and
  giant directories and long file names. The new dir code has three
  patches itself:

   - skip forward to the next directory entry if seek is short
   - invalidate stored directory on seek
   - count directory pieces correctly"

<title>orangefs: skip forward to the next directory entry if seek is short</title>
<updated>2017-05-04T18:38:10+00:00</updated>
<author>
<name>Martin Brandenburg</name>
<email>martin@omnibond.com</email>
</author>
<published>2017-05-02T16:15:10+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=bf15ba7c1f9ad000d062968f931e80234db84a24'/>
<id>bf15ba7c1f9ad000d062968f931e80234db84a24</id>
<content type='text'>
If userspace seeks to a position in the stream which is not correct, it
would have returned EIO because the data in the buffer at that offset
would be incorrect.  This and the userspace daemon returning a corrupt
directory are indistinguishable.

Now if the data does not look right, skip forward to the next chunk and
try again.  The motivation is that if the directory changes, an
application may seek to a position that was valid and no longer is valid.

It is not yet possible for a directory to change.

<title>orangefs: handle zero size write in debugfs</title>
<updated>2017-04-26T18:33:01+00:00</updated>
<author>
<name>Dan Carpenter</name>
<email>dan.carpenter@oracle.com</email>
</author>
<published>2017-04-14T19:11:53+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=907bfcd8d8a616ca794ba187f6bf1b0e12b3a8dd'/>
<id>907bfcd8d8a616ca794ba187f6bf1b0e12b3a8dd</id>
<content type='text'>
If we write zero bytes to this debugfs file, then it will cause an
underflow when we do copy_from_user(buf, ubuf, count - 1).  Debugfs can
normally only be written to by root so the impact of this is low.

<title>orangefs: do not wait for timeout if umounting</title>
<updated>2017-04-26T18:33:01+00:00</updated>
<author>
<name>Martin Brandenburg</name>
<email>martin@omnibond.com</email>
</author>
<published>2017-04-25T19:38:07+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=b5a9d61eebdd0016ccb383b25a5c3d04977a6549'/>
<id>b5a9d61eebdd0016ccb383b25a5c3d04977a6549</id>
<content type='text'>
When the computer is turned off, all the processes are killed and then
all the filesystems are umounted.  OrangeFS should not wait for the
userspace daemon to come back in that case.

This only works for plain umount(2).  To actually take advantage of this
interactively, `umount -f' is needed; otherwise umount will issue a
statfs first, which will wait for the userspace daemon to come back.

<title>orangefs: do not check possibly stale size on truncate</title>
<updated>2017-04-26T18:33:00+00:00</updated>
<author>
<name>Martin Brandenburg</name>
<email>martin@omnibond.com</email>
</author>
<published>2017-04-25T19:38:04+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=53950ef541675df48c219a8d665111a0e68dfc2f'/>
<id>53950ef541675df48c219a8d665111a0e68dfc2f</id>
<content type='text'>
Let the server figure this out because our size might be out of date or
not present.

The bug was that

	xfs_io -f -t -c "pread -v 0 100" /mnt/foo
	echo "Test" &gt; /mnt/foo
	xfs_io -f -t -c "pread -v 0 100" /mnt/foo

fails because the second truncate did not happen if nothing had
requested the size after the write in echo.  Thus i_size was zero (not
present) and the orangefs_setattr though i_size was zero and there was
nothing to do.

<title>orangefs: implement statx</title>
<updated>2017-04-26T18:33:00+00:00</updated>
<author>
<name>Martin Brandenburg</name>
<email>martin@omnibond.com</email>
</author>
<published>2017-04-25T19:38:03+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=68a24a6cc4a6025e111c282186a2506281d79b4b'/>
<id>68a24a6cc4a6025e111c282186a2506281d79b4b</id>
<content type='text'>
Fortunately OrangeFS has had a getattr request mask for a long time.

The server basically has two difficulty levels for attributes.  Fetching
any attribute except size requires communicating with the metadata
server for that handle.  Since all the attributes are right there, it
makes sense to return them all.  Fetching the size requires
communicating with every I/O server (that the file is distributed
across).  Therefore if asked for anything except size, get everything
except size, and if asked for size, get everything.
